Onboarding note for the Ledgerpane admin table: bulk edits are applied through the batcher service, not directly against the database. Select rows, choose an action, and the batcher stages changes in a pending set you can review before commit. Edits over 500 rows require a second approver — this is enforced server-side, so don't try to chunk around it. To run the batcher locally you need the staging write credential, which goes in your .env as the next line.

secret setting of bahip-kagag: RELAY_SECRET3=c83

### Restarting the crash-report ingester

If Fernwheel's mobile crash reports stop flowing into the Sievemark pipeline, first verify the ingester pods are healthy, then drain and restart the symbolication queue in the order listed in section 4. Do not restart the dedup worker first, as this can duplicate alert pages. Once the queue is drained, re-authenticate the ingester against the internal Sievemark collector using the key below.

gateway credential: kto3_qfe

# Locker Assignment — Changing Rooms

Lockers in the Hobsmere changing rooms are assigned by reception, not self-selected. Check the locker register before issuing; rows A–C are reserved for cycle commuters, row D for gym users. One locker per person. Overnight storage allowed max 5 working days, then contents go to facilities holding. Lost locker keys incur a replacement charge; log these in the register. To unlock the master cabinet holding spare keys and the assignment ledger, use the code below.

badge for yajep-tawip: bdg-UBYAH-39947